What is the procedure to request judicial authorization to perform non-invasive medical treatments on a minor in Chile?

The procedure to request judicial authorization to perform non-invasive medical treatments on a minor in Chile involves filing a lawsuit before the corresponding family court. Medical evidence and arguments must be presented to demonstrate the need and feasibility of the treatment, as well as its benefit to the child's well-being. The court will evaluate the evidence and make a decision considering the best interests of the minor.

What is the relationship between money laundering and other financial crimes, such as corruption and fraud in Honduras?

There is a close relationship between money laundering and other financial crimes, such as corruption and fraud, in Honduras. These crimes are interconnected and are often used as complementary stages in a broader criminal process. Illicit funds obtained through corruption and fraud are laundered to hide their origin and appear legal.

What is the fiscal impact of import operations in Argentina?

Import operations are subject to customs taxes and VAT. Importers must comply with customs tax obligations and pay taxes before removing the merchandise.
